kepler.gl
Version:
kepler.gl is a webgl based application to visualize large scale location data in the browser
39 lines (36 loc) • 3.86 kB
JavaScript
var _interopRequireDefault = require("@babel/runtime/helpers/interopRequireDefault");
Object.defineProperty(exports, "__esModule", {
value: true
});
exports["default"] = void 0;
var _react = _interopRequireDefault(require("react"));
// SPDX-License-Identifier: MIT
// Copyright contributors to the kepler.gl project
// This is a dummy component that can be replaced to inject more side panel sub panels into the side bar
function CustomPanelsFactory() {
var CustomPanels = function CustomPanels() {
return /*#__PURE__*/_react["default"].createElement("div", null);
};
// provide a list of additional panels
CustomPanels.panels = [
// {
// id: 'rocket',
// label: 'Rocket',
// iconComponent: Icons.Rocket
// },
// {
// id: 'chart',
// label: 'Chart',
// iconComponent: Icons.LineChart
// }
];
// prop selector from side panel props
// eslint-disable-next-line @typescript-eslint/no-unused-vars
CustomPanels.getProps = function (sidePanelProps) {
return {};
};
return CustomPanels;
}
var _default = exports["default"] = CustomPanelsFactory;
//# sourceMappingURL=data:application/json;charset=utf-8;base64,eyJ2ZXJzaW9uIjozLCJuYW1lcyI6WyJfcmVhY3QiLCJfaW50ZXJvcFJlcXVpcmVEZWZhdWx0IiwicmVxdWlyZSIsIkN1c3RvbVBhbmVsc0ZhY3RvcnkiLCJDdXN0b21QYW5lbHMiLCJjcmVhdGVFbGVtZW50IiwicGFuZWxzIiwiZ2V0UHJvcHMiLCJzaWRlUGFuZWxQcm9wcyIsIl9kZWZhdWx0IiwiZXhwb3J0cyJdLCJzb3VyY2VzIjpbIi4uLy4uL3NyYy9zaWRlLXBhbmVsL2N1c3RvbS1wYW5lbC50c3giXSwic291cmNlc0NvbnRlbnQiOlsiLy8gU1BEWC1MaWNlbnNlLUlkZW50aWZpZXI6IE1JVFxuLy8gQ29weXJpZ2h0IGNvbnRyaWJ1dG9ycyB0byB0aGUga2VwbGVyLmdsIHByb2plY3RcblxuaW1wb3J0IFJlYWN0IGZyb20gJ3JlYWN0JztcbmltcG9ydCB7U2lkZVBhbmVsSXRlbSwgU2lkZVBhbmVsUHJvcHN9IGZyb20gJy4uL3R5cGVzJztcbmltcG9ydCB7UkdCQ29sb3J9IGZyb20gJ0BrZXBsZXIuZ2wvdHlwZXMnO1xuXG5leHBvcnQgdHlwZSBDdXN0b21QYW5lbHNTdGF0aWNQcm9wczxQPiA9IHtcbiAgcGFuZWxzOiBTaWRlUGFuZWxJdGVtW107XG4gIGdldFByb3BzPzogKHByb3BzOiBTaWRlUGFuZWxQcm9wcykgPT4gUDtcbn07XG5leHBvcnQgdHlwZSBDdXN0b21QYW5lbHNQcm9wcyA9IHtcbiAgYWN0aXZlU2lkZVBhbmVsOiBzdHJpbmcgfCBudWxsO1xuICB1cGRhdGVUYWJsZUNvbG9yOiAoZGF0YUlkOiBzdHJpbmcsIG5ld0NvbG9yOiBSR0JDb2xvcikgPT4gdm9pZDtcbn07XG5cbi8vIFRoaXMgaXMgYSBkdW1teSBjb21wb25lbnQgdGhhdCBjYW4gYmUgcmVwbGFjZWQgdG8gaW5qZWN0IG1vcmUgc2lkZSBwYW5lbCBzdWIgcGFuZWxzIGludG8gdGhlIHNpZGUgYmFyXG5mdW5jdGlvbiBDdXN0b21QYW5lbHNGYWN0b3J5PFA+KCkge1xuICBjb25zdCBDdXN0b21QYW5lbHM6IFJlYWN0LkZDPEN1c3RvbVBhbmVsc1Byb3BzPiAmIEN1c3RvbVBhbmVsc1N0YXRpY1Byb3BzPFA+ID0gKCkgPT4ge1xuICAgIHJldHVybiA8ZGl2IC8+O1xuICB9O1xuICAvLyBwcm92aWRlIGEgbGlzdCBvZiBhZGRpdGlvbmFsIHBhbmVsc1xuICBDdXN0b21QYW5lbHMucGFuZWxzID0gW1xuICAgIC8vIHtcbiAgICAvLyAgIGlkOiAncm9ja2V0JyxcbiAgICAvLyAgIGxhYmVsOiAnUm9ja2V0JyxcbiAgICAvLyAgIGljb25Db21wb25lbnQ6IEljb25zLlJvY2tldFxuICAgIC8vIH0sXG4gICAgLy8ge1xuICAgIC8vICAgaWQ6ICdjaGFydCcsXG4gICAgLy8gICBsYWJlbDogJ0NoYXJ0JyxcbiAgICAvLyAgIGljb25Db21wb25lbnQ6IEljb25zLkxpbmVDaGFydFxuICAgIC8vIH1cbiAgXTtcblxuICAvLyBwcm9wIHNlbGVjdG9yIGZyb20gc2lkZSBwYW5lbCBwcm9wc1xuICAvLyBlc2xpbnQtZGlzYWJsZS1uZXh0LWxpbmUgQHR5cGVzY3JpcHQtZXNsaW50L25vLXVudXNlZC12YXJzXG4gIEN1c3RvbVBhbmVscy5nZXRQcm9wcyA9IChzaWRlUGFuZWxQcm9wczogU2lkZVBhbmVsUHJvcHMpID0+ICh7fSBhcyBQKTtcblxuICByZXR1cm4gQ3VzdG9tUGFuZWxzO1xufVxuXG5leHBvcnQgZGVmYXVsdCBDdXN0b21QYW5lbHNGYWN0b3J5O1xuIl0sIm1hcHBpbmdzIjoiOzs7Ozs7O0FBR0EsSUFBQUEsTUFBQSxHQUFBQyxzQkFBQSxDQUFBQyxPQUFBO0FBSEE7QUFDQTs7QUFlQTtBQUNBLFNBQVNDLG1CQUFtQkEsQ0FBQSxFQUFNO0VBQ2hDLElBQU1DLFlBQXNFLEdBQUcsU0FBekVBLFlBQXNFQSxDQUFBLEVBQVM7SUFDbkYsb0JBQU9KLE1BQUEsWUFBQUssYUFBQSxZQUFNLENBQUM7RUFDaEIsQ0FBQztFQUNEO0VBQ0FELFlBQVksQ0FBQ0UsTUFBTSxHQUFHO0lBQ3BCO0lBQ0E7SUFDQTtJQUNBO0lBQ0E7SUFDQTtJQUNBO0lBQ0E7SUFDQTtJQUNBO0VBQUEsQ0FDRDs7RUFFRDtFQUNBO0VBQ0FGLFlBQVksQ0FBQ0csUUFBUSxHQUFHLFVBQUNDLGNBQThCO0lBQUEsT0FBTSxDQUFDLENBQUM7RUFBQSxDQUFNO0VBRXJFLE9BQU9KLFlBQVk7QUFDckI7QUFBQyxJQUFBSyxRQUFBLEdBQUFDLE9BQUEsY0FFY1AsbUJBQW1CIiwiaWdub3JlTGlzdCI6W119
;